Use the formula for the shape or substance
Measure length, width, and height for a rectangular solid
Calculate volume with V = l × w × h
Measure radius for a cylinder
Calculate volume with V = πr²h
Measure radius for a sphere
Calculate volume with V = 4/3 πr³
Use mass and density if volume is unknown
Calculate volume with V = m ÷ d
Use a graduated cylinder for liquids
Read the liquid level at eye level
Use water displacement for irregular objects
Subtract initial water level from final water level
Convert units as needed
Express volume in cubic units or liters
